Ikeda Kunishige Gyuto
The Gyuto is a versatile knife used for portioning, thin slicing, and chopping meat, fish, vegetables, and other ingredients.
This is a clean Gyuto from the Kunishige brand.
The black area of the blade has been treated with black oxide.
The black oxide finish creates a stable oxide layer on the iron surface, helping to suppress red rust while giving the blade a subdued black appearance.
The rugged black blade and the silver-colored sharpened edge create a distinct contrast, giving the tool a strong presence.
With continued use, the appearance of the black oxide area will gradually change, which is part of the appeal of a carbon steel knife.
This is not a new knife treated with black oxide, so the depth of the black color may vary, but these variations can be enjoyed as part of its character.
This double-beveled knife is made of carbon steel and offers excellent sharpness.
